Marble Cake I

Marble Cake I recipe

Marble cake gets its name from the beautiful marbled pattern created by combining two different-colored batters.

Ingredients
  • 2 cup All-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on Ba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 cup Unsalted butter
  • 1.5 cup Granulated sugar
  • 3 large Eggs
  • 2 teaspoon Vanilla extract
  • 0.75 cup Milk
  • 3 tablespoon Cocoa powder
Instructions
  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 9-inch (23 cm) cake pan.
  2. In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t.
  3. In a large bowl, cream together the but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the vanilla extract.
  4. Gradually mix in the dry ingredients, alternating with the milk. Begin and end with the dry ingredients.
  5. Divide the batter into two equal portions. In one portion, mix in the cocoa powder.
  6. Spoon alternating dollops of the vanilla and chocolate batters into the prepared cake pan. Use a skewer or knife to create a marbled effect.
  7. Bake for 40-45 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  8. Allow the cake to c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
  9. Serve and enjoy!
